Walmart testing higher starting wage for certain workers

Walmart's spokesperson Jami Lamontagne said on Friday that the company would be testing a higher minimum wage of $12 an hour for some employees.

Bombardier approaches Alstom and Hitachi for possible merger

According to sources with knowledge of the matter, Bombardier has approached Japan's Hitachi and France's Alstom for a possible rail merger deal.

European Commission asks ECJ to freeze new Polish law

On Friday, the European Commission has filed an application before the European Court of Justice, asking the court to suspend Poland's law, set up to discipline judges.

Angola could ask Portugal to Freeze dos Santos' assets

On Friday, Helder Pitta Gros, Angola's prosecutor, said that Angola may request Portugal's government to confiscate assets belonging to Isabel dos Santos, the daughter of Angola's former President.

Intel shares hit highest level in nearly two decades

On Friday, shares of Intel Corp reached its highest level in almost two decades, as the demand for cloud computing lifted Intel's data center business.

Boeing planning to cut 787 Dreamliner production

According to people with knowledge of the matter, Boeing is thinking to cut production of its 787 Dreamliner to 10 aircraft a month, amid a shortage of orders from China.

Crude oil prices decline more than 2%

On Friday, crude oil prices edged lower by more than 2%. Brent crude futures were down by 2.3%, at $60.62 at 11:49 EST.

European shares edge higher on Friday

On Friday, European stocks edged higher, as the Purchasing Managers Index (PMI) came in slightly better-than-expected. The Pan-European STOXX 600 climbed 0.9%.

Siemens buys Indian C&S Electric in $296M deal

Siemens bought Indian electrical equipment producer C&S Electric in a $296.21M deal, the German industrial group announced on Friday.

Canada's retail sales increase 0.9%

Canada's retail sales grew more-than-expected 0.9% in November, offsetting the prior month's decline, amid higher sales of motor vehicles and food and beverage.

Daimler to manufacture 50K Mercedes EQC models in 2020

Daimler is planning to build 50K of Mercedes EQC electric vehicles in 2020, dispelling doubts of Manager Magazin that claimed the carmaker was forced to cut the 2020 production targets amid battery supply problems.

Italy's Poste rolls out new payment technology

Poste Italiane is rolling out its new Codice PostePay payment technology based on QR codes, which allows customers to pay for services only by using their mobile phone, as the ex-monopolist aims to lure more clients among small businesses in Italy.

AmEx Q4 profit tops analysts' forecasts

On Friday, American Express, the credit card issuer, reported its fourth-quarter profit had topped analysts' estimates on strong holiday season spending in the United States.

Poland's LOT to acquire German carrier Condor

LOT, the Polish airline, is acquiring Germany's carrier Condor, previously owned by Thomas Cook; however, the financial details had not been revealed yet, Reuters reported on Friday.

ECB's Klaas Knot comments on inflation

On Friday, the ECB Board Member Klaas Knot announced that the central bank should clarify its annual inflation target so that it is the same in each Eurozone country.

Nestle ties up with Canada plant-based ingredients makers

The food group Nestle tied up with Burcon and Merit, Canada's plant-based food ingredient producers, to accelerate innovation in the rapid-growing business industry, the company announced on Friday.

Ericsson Q4 core profit hit by US business slowdown

On Friday, Ericsson, Sweden's telecoms equipment group, reported weaker-than-expected Q4 core earnings, hit by higher costs and a slump in its US business.

Uber to roll out autonomous cars in Washington

Uber Technologies is set to put its self-driving cars with humans in control on the roads of Washington on Friday, seeking to collect data for further deployment of fully autonomous vehicles.

Colgate to acquire US vegan toothpaste maker

Colgate-Palmolive announced it would acquire Hello Products, the animal cruelty-free and eco-friendly toothpaste maker, as the company seeks expansion in the industry aimed at environmentally conscious consumers.

Intel expects 2020 revenue to top forecasts

Intel Corp is expecting its 2020 profit and revenue to beat analysts' forecasts, as demand for the company's chips and cloud computing is starting to recover, Intel's CFO George Davis said.

Tesla becomes world's new second most valuable automaker

Tesla Inc overtook Germany's Volkswagen as the second most valuable automaker in the world behind Japan's Toyota, on the meteoric surge in the US electric vehicle manufacturer's shares that reshuffled the global market.

Broadcom plans supplying wireless components to Apple

The chipmaker Broadcom announced the two multi-year agreements signed with Apple Inc to supply wireless components used in the tech giant's products, sending Broadcom's shares up 2% on the news.
